Tupelos World Cafe
based on 6 member reviews
506 W King St, Boone North Carolina
28607
828-262-5000 Type: Ovo, Lacto, Vegan-friendly, International, Juice bar, Beer/Wine, Not 100% Vegetarian Info: Serves meat, veg options available. Eco-friendly cafe serving international cuisine with emphasis on local and organic ingredients. Has vegan and vegetarian food options. Try the galam masala curry dish with tempeh and banana-ginger-spiced smoothie. Has outdoor seating. Formerly the location of Angelica's restaurant. www.tupelosworldcafe.com Has outdoor seating. Accepts credit cards. Price: Moderate.

Review: When I heard that the (purely vegetarian) Angelica's had shut down, I was really disappointed. But I soon perked up after hearing that the owners of Angelica's had created Tupelos World Cafe in its place. Unfortunately, TWC now serves meat in addition to some of Angelica's old veg favorites, but their food is still amazing!
I highly recommend the Avocado Tempeh Melt -- a mixture of sauteed veggies, jalapeno jack cheese and perfectly spiced tempeh topped onto fresh, homemade bread. Also, the sweet tanginess of the Garam Masala Curry (with the tempeh or tofu option) is quite tasty... and vegan!
The staff is friendly and helpful, so questions and concerns about ingredients are welcome. So sit back, relax, and enjoy your globally inspired meal in this unassuming, mountainside spot.
